May 7, 2025
No Comments
Beyond Human Eyes: The Magic of Computer Vision in Solving Real-World Problems
The world of artificial intelligence (AI) is growing rapidly, with one of the most exciting fields being computer vision. This technology enables machines to interpret and make decisions based on visual data, much like the human eye and brain. From smartphones to surveillance systems, computer vision is increasingly transforming how we interact with the world around us, automating tasks and making processes more efficient. At MindsTek AI, we are at the forefront of this technological revolution, helping businesses harness the power of computer vision to drive innovation and success.
What is Computer Vision?
At its core, computer vision is a field of AI that trains machines to “see” and interpret images, videos, and other visual data. It’s the technology behind face recognition on your phone, self-driving cars detecting pedestrians, and e-commerce platforms recognizing products in images.
Key Technologies Behind Computer Vision
Several technologies power computer vision, making it possible for machines to understand and process visual information effectively. Some of the key technologies include:
* Convolutional Neural Networks (CNNs): CNNs are deep learning algorithms designed to recognize visual patterns. They mimic how the human brain processes images. For example, a CNN might recognize patterns in an image to distinguish between a cat and a dog.
* You Only Look Once (YOLO): YOLO is a real-time object detection system that allows machines to identify and classify multiple objects within an image or video. It is incredibly fast and efficient, making it ideal for applications like surveillance, autonomous driving, and retail.
* Image Segmentation: This technology divides an image into parts to identify and label each object. It's often used in medical imaging, where different tissues or organs need to be separated and analyzed individually.
* Facial Recognition: Facial recognition uses computer vision to identify individuals by analyzing their facial features. It's used in everything from unlocking smartphones to tracking people in security systems.
* Convolutional Neural Networks (CNNs): CNNs are deep learning algorithms designed to recognize visual patterns. They mimic how the human brain processes images. For example, a CNN might recognize patterns in an image to distinguish between a cat and a dog.
* You Only Look Once (YOLO): YOLO is a real-time object detection system that allows machines to identify and classify multiple objects within an image or video. It is incredibly fast and efficient, making it ideal for applications like surveillance, autonomous driving, and retail.
* Image Segmentation: This technology divides an image into parts to identify and label each object. It's often used in medical imaging, where different tissues or organs need to be separated and analyzed individually.
* Facial Recognition: Facial recognition uses computer vision to identify individuals by analyzing their facial features. It's used in everything from unlocking smartphones to tracking people in security systems.
How Computer Vision is Revolutionizing Industries
1. E-Commerce and Retail
For businesses in e-commerce and retail, computer vision is a game-changer. Imagine browsing through an online store, and instead of scrolling through endless product listings, you simply take a picture of an item you like, and the store shows you similar products. This is made possible by computer vision technologies.
Example: Many fashion brands now use visual search engines powered by computer vision to let customers find items through images. Instead of typing in descriptions, customers upload a picture, and the system uses computer vision to find similar products.
2. Healthcare
In healthcare, computer vision is being used to analyze medical images like X-rays, MRIs, and CT scans. It helps doctors detect diseases earlier, more accurately, and in a less invasive way.
Example: In cancer detection, algorithms trained with computer vision can scan an X-ray and identify potential tumors much faster than a human doctor. This not only speeds up diagnosis but also increases the accuracy of detecting early-stage cancers.
3. Manufacturing
Manufacturers are using computer vision for quality control, inspecting products on assembly lines for defects, and ensuring that parts are aligned correctly. This increases the efficiency of production lines and reduces human error.
Example: In car manufacturing, computer vision systems inspect each vehicle part to check for defects like cracks or scratches before they are sent out for delivery. This reduces the risk of faulty products reaching customers.
4. Surveillance and Security
Computer vision is also being heavily used in surveillance systems to improve security in public spaces, airports, and businesses. It helps identify suspicious activities, track individuals, and even recognize faces from a crowd.
Example: Security cameras equipped with computer vision software can alert security personnel if a person is loitering or acting suspiciously. It can also match faces to a database of known individuals, improving safety in high-risk environments.
For businesses in e-commerce and retail, computer vision is a game-changer. Imagine browsing through an online store, and instead of scrolling through endless product listings, you simply take a picture of an item you like, and the store shows you similar products. This is made possible by computer vision technologies.
Example: Many fashion brands now use visual search engines powered by computer vision to let customers find items through images. Instead of typing in descriptions, customers upload a picture, and the system uses computer vision to find similar products.
2. Healthcare
In healthcare, computer vision is being used to analyze medical images like X-rays, MRIs, and CT scans. It helps doctors detect diseases earlier, more accurately, and in a less invasive way.
Example: In cancer detection, algorithms trained with computer vision can scan an X-ray and identify potential tumors much faster than a human doctor. This not only speeds up diagnosis but also increases the accuracy of detecting early-stage cancers.
3. Manufacturing
Manufacturers are using computer vision for quality control, inspecting products on assembly lines for defects, and ensuring that parts are aligned correctly. This increases the efficiency of production lines and reduces human error.
Example: In car manufacturing, computer vision systems inspect each vehicle part to check for defects like cracks or scratches before they are sent out for delivery. This reduces the risk of faulty products reaching customers.
4. Surveillance and Security
Computer vision is also being heavily used in surveillance systems to improve security in public spaces, airports, and businesses. It helps identify suspicious activities, track individuals, and even recognize faces from a crowd.
Example: Security cameras equipped with computer vision software can alert security personnel if a person is loitering or acting suspiciously. It can also match faces to a database of known individuals, improving safety in high-risk environments.
"The future of computer vision is to enable machines to understand the world as we do, using sight to make smarter decisions for us."
Dr. Fei-Fei Li
Pioneer in Computer Vision


Research and Progress in Computer Vision
The field of computer vision is evolving rapidly. Research is particularly active in areas like autonomous vehicles, healthcare diagnostics, and improving object detection algorithms. Self-driving cars, for instance, rely on computer vision to navigate the roads and recognize obstacles in real-time. Research in deep learning is making it possible for machines to see and understand images in much the same way humans do.
In healthcare, researchers are focusing on improving the accuracy and speed of computer vision algorithms to make them more reliable in diagnosing conditions like cancer, heart disease, and neurological disorders.
The retail sector is also making strides, with major companies developing visual search systems, AI-powered fitting rooms, and personalized shopping experiences that are powered by computer vision.
The Pros and Cons of Computer Vision
Pros:
Increased Efficiency: Computer vision automates tasks like quality control, reducing the need for manual inspections and speeding up processes.
Improved Accuracy: It can process vast amounts of visual data much faster and more accurately than humans, making it invaluable in fields like healthcare.
Cost Savings: By automating tasks, businesses can reduce labor costs and minimize human error.
Cons
Privacy Concerns: The use of facial recognition and surveillance can raise privacy concerns, especially if used without proper consent or regulation.
Bias: AI models, including those for computer vision, can sometimes be biased if they are trained on unrepresentative data. This can lead to inaccuracies, especially in sensitive applications like hiring or law enforcement.
High Costs: Implementing computer vision technologies can be expensive, especially for smaller businesses that may not have the budget for advanced hardware and software.
In healthcare, researchers are focusing on improving the accuracy and speed of computer vision algorithms to make them more reliable in diagnosing conditions like cancer, heart disease, and neurological disorders.
The retail sector is also making strides, with major companies developing visual search systems, AI-powered fitting rooms, and personalized shopping experiences that are powered by computer vision.
The Pros and Cons of Computer Vision
Pros:Increased Efficiency: Computer vision automates tasks like quality control, reducing the need for manual inspections and speeding up processes.
Improved Accuracy: It can process vast amounts of visual data much faster and more accurately than humans, making it invaluable in fields like healthcare.
Cost Savings: By automating tasks, businesses can reduce labor costs and minimize human error.
Privacy Concerns: The use of facial recognition and surveillance can raise privacy concerns, especially if used without proper consent or regulation.
Bias: AI models, including those for computer vision, can sometimes be biased if they are trained on unrepresentative data. This can lead to inaccuracies, especially in sensitive applications like hiring or law enforcement.
High Costs: Implementing computer vision technologies can be expensive, especially for smaller businesses that may not have the budget for advanced hardware and software.
Popular FAQs About Computer Vision
Qes. 1. What is the difference between object detection and image classification?
Ans. 1: Object detection involves identifying and locating objects within an image, while image classification only involves identifying what objects are in the image, without determining their location.
Qes. 2. Can computer vision be used for live video?
Ans. 2: Yes, computer vision is widely used for real-time video analysis, such as in surveillance systems and self-driving cars.
Qes: 3. What industries are using computer vision the most?
Ans. 3: E-commerce, healthcare, manufacturing, security, and automotive industries are among the top sectors utilizing computer vision technologies.
Qes. 4. How accurate is computer vision?
Ans. 4: The accuracy of computer vision systems depends on the quality of the training data and the algorithms used. In some cases, they can exceed human accuracy, but in others, especially with biased data, errors can occur.
Ans. 1: Object detection involves identifying and locating objects within an image, while image classification only involves identifying what objects are in the image, without determining their location.
Qes. 2. Can computer vision be used for live video?
Ans. 2: Yes, computer vision is widely used for real-time video analysis, such as in surveillance systems and self-driving cars.
Qes: 3. What industries are using computer vision the most?
Ans. 3: E-commerce, healthcare, manufacturing, security, and automotive industries are among the top sectors utilizing computer vision technologies.
Qes. 4. How accurate is computer vision?
Ans. 4: The accuracy of computer vision systems depends on the quality of the training data and the algorithms used. In some cases, they can exceed human accuracy, but in others, especially with biased data, errors can occur.


How MindsTek AI Helps Businesses Leverage Computer Vision
At MindsTek AI, we specialize in helping businesses integrate cutting-edge computer vision technologies to improve their operations and customer experiences. Our expert engineers tailor solutions to meet the specific needs of each client, ensuring that they get the most out of AI-powered visual data analysis.
Case Study 1: E-Commerce Visual Search for Fashion Retailer
We helped a fashion retailer build a visual search engine that allowed their customers to upload images and receive recommendations for similar products. The implementation of this computer vision technology resulted in a 30% increase in conversion rates and a significant improvement in customer satisfaction.
Case Study 2: Healthcare Imaging for Early Cancer Detection
In collaboration with a healthcare provider, we developed an AI-driven system that analyzed X-rays and CT scans to detect early signs of cancer. This system improved diagnostic speed by 40% and significantly enhanced accuracy, providing doctors with more reliable tools to save lives.
Case Study 3: Manufacturing Defect Detection
A manufacturing client used our computer vision solution to inspect products on their assembly line for defects. The system identified errors that human inspectors missed, reducing the defect rate by 25% and improving overall production efficiency.
Case Study 1: E-Commerce Visual Search for Fashion Retailer
We helped a fashion retailer build a visual search engine that allowed their customers to upload images and receive recommendations for similar products. The implementation of this computer vision technology resulted in a 30% increase in conversion rates and a significant improvement in customer satisfaction.
Case Study 2: Healthcare Imaging for Early Cancer Detection
In collaboration with a healthcare provider, we developed an AI-driven system that analyzed X-rays and CT scans to detect early signs of cancer. This system improved diagnostic speed by 40% and significantly enhanced accuracy, providing doctors with more reliable tools to save lives.
Case Study 3: Manufacturing Defect Detection
A manufacturing client used our computer vision solution to inspect products on their assembly line for defects. The system identified errors that human inspectors missed, reducing the defect rate by 25% and improving overall production efficiency.